电子抢答器设计.doc
更新时间:02-16 上传会员:熊猫小黑
分类:
理工论文
论文字数:15209 需要金币:1000个
下载此论文
摘要:本课题设计可供8人使用的电子抢答器,设计内容主要包括的系统硬件电路设计、系统软件设计、仿真调试。系统以ATS89C52单片机为核心,配置独立式按键开关12个、执行选手和时间提示功能的LED显示器4位,另有74HC573锁存器等逻辑电路共同组成硬件电路系统。系统的软件部分采用C语言进行编程,并在Proteus仿真环境下对所设计的电子抢答器进行仿真调试。运行调试情况表明:8人抢答器可以做到进行限时抢答,回答倒计时,违规报警,抢答互锁,随机抽取选手回答,LED数码管能够显示抢答成功者编号、能够对抢答倒计时时间和回答倒计时进行实时提示,还有指示灯对主持人或选手按键的按键提示和蜂鸣报警等功能。该抢答器的设计实现了预期的目标,完成了毕业设计规定任务。
关键词:单片机 锁存器 定时器/计数器 Proteus软件
目 录
摘 要
ABSTRACT
1 绪 论-1
1.1课题研究的背景-1
1.2国内外研究现状-1
1.3课题内容及目的意义-2
2 总体方案设计-6
2.1控制器的选择-6
2.2抢答器的基本工作模式-7
2.3总体方案设计-7
2.4总体设计框图-7
3 硬件电路设计-6
3.1 AT89C52单片机-6
3.2时钟电路设计-7
3.2.1晶振频率的选择-7
3.2.2振荡方式的选择-7
3.3复位电路设计-8
3.4显示电路设计-9
3.5报警模块的选择-10
3.6按键接口电路设计-11
3.6.1键盘选择-11
3.6.2按键消抖-12
3.7锁存模块的选择-12
3.8硬件电路原理图-14
4 软件设计-15
4.1软件主流程设计-15
4.2软件实现的功能-16
4.2.1主持人按键的判定-16
4.2.2选手按键编号的确定-17
4.2.3抢答按键编号的锁存-17
4.2.4定时器/计数器的编程使用-18
4.2.5数码管显示控制-19
5 仿真调试-21
5.1仿真软件-21
5.2仿真调试-21
6 设计总结-23
参考文献-24
致 谢-25
附 录-26
附录1 电子抢答器系统电路原理图-26
附录2 电子抢答器系统仿真电路图-27
附录3 系统SCH电路原理图-28
附录4 源程序清单-29
上一篇:
10吨汽车起重机液压系统设计.doc
下一篇:
多工位转盘式上下料料仓设计.doc
找原创论文,从三亿论文网开始 www.eeelw.com
电脑版
|
目标:为大家提供3亿可以通过查重系统的原创毕业论文资料